Grasping Nutritional Density

Though many individuals prioritize macronutrients like proteins and fats, grasping nutrient density uncovers the overlooked value of foods, especially in the case of grass-fed beef organs. Nutrient density refers to the concentration of essential vitamins, minerals, and other beneficial compounds compared to the number of calories in a food item. Grass-fed beef organs, including liver and heart, are often rich in micronutrients including vitamin A, B vitamins, iron, and zinc. These organs deliver an exceptional nutrient profile relative to traditional muscle meats, which may be missing certain crucial nutrients. By prioritizing nutrient density, individuals can make more educated dietary choices, enhancing health benefits while minimizing calorie intake. This understanding emphasizes the importance of incorporating nutrient-dense foods into a balanced diet.

Nutrition Powerhouses

Beef organs are often overlooked, yet they serve as nutritional powerhouses packed with essential vitamins and minerals. Organs such as liver, heart, and kidneys, abundant in iron, zinc, and B vitamins, provide remarkable health benefits. The liver, in particular, is celebrated for its elevated vitamin A content, necessary for immune function and vision. As a superior source of CoQ10, heart contains a compound that promotes energy production and cardiovascular health. Kidneys also aid in the body's detoxification processes. Grass-fed beef organs provide superior nutrient profiles because of their diet and lifestyle, supporting overall well-being. Integrating these nutrient-packed foods into your diet can bring about superior health outcomes and elevated energy, proving them a valuable component of a balanced nutrition plan.

Important Nutrients Present in Organ Meats

Organ meats, frequently considered nutritional powerhouses, are abundant sources of essential vitamins and minerals that play vital roles in human health. These organs, including liver, heart, and kidneys, offer an abundance of nutrients. Liver is particularly remarkable for its high levels of vitamin A, essential for vision and immune function, and B vitamins, which are essential for energy metabolism. Moreover, organ meats are excellent sources of iron, zinc, and selenium, crucial for red blood cell production, immune response, and antioxidant defense. The presence of coenzyme Q10 in heart tissue promotes cardiovascular health. Overall, including organ meats in your diet can substantially boost nutrient intake, contributing to overall well-being and addressing common deficiencies found in many modern diets.

Contrasting Conventional vs. Grass-Fed Beef

Nutritional profiles of grass-fed and conventional beef can vary markedly, influencing health outcomes and dietary choices. Grass-fed beef typically contains elevated amounts of omega-3 fatty acids and conjugated linoleic acid (CLA), which are linked to anti-inflammatory properties and improved heart health. Furthermore, it often boasts increased levels of vitamins A and E, as well as antioxidants like glutathione. In contrast, conventional beef generally has a higher fat content, particularly saturated fat, and is deficient in the beneficial nutrient profile found in its grass-fed counterpart. The differences originate primarily from the animals' diets; grass-fed cattle consume a natural diet of forage, while conventional cattle are often grain-fed. This dietary distinction substantially influences the overall nutritional quality of the beef produced.

How to Include Beef Organs in Your Eating Plan

Including beef organs into the diet can enhance nutritional intake significantly, as these nutrient-dense foods offer a variety of vitamins and minerals often absent in conventional meat cuts. One practical method is to start with small amounts, such as adding ground liver to meat patties or burgers, gradually increasing the proportion as palates adjust. Dehydrated organ supplements present a convenient option for those reluctant about taste or texture. Additionally, incorporating organ meats into conventional dishes, such as stews or pâtés, can conceal flavors while improving nutrition. Cooking techniques like mixing or pureeing can also make organ meats more enjoyable. Ultimately, sourcing grass-fed options ensures higher nutrient density, making the change to including beef organs both rewarding and enjoyable.

Are There Any Potential Risks When Consuming Beef Organs?

Consuming beef organs involves potential hazards, including contact with toxins, increased cholesterol levels, and foodborne diseases if not correctly handled. Balanced intake and sourcing from trusted suppliers can reduce some of these health risks.

How Do You Store Beef Organs to Keep Them Fresh?

Beef organs must be placed in airtight containers, preferably vacuum-sealed, and maintained in the refrigerator if eaten within a few days. Freezing is recommended for longer-term storage to maintain freshness and prevent spoilage.

What Cooking Methods Work Best for Beef Organs?

The ideal cooking methods for beef organs include slow cooking, braising, and sautéing. These approaches boost tenderness and flavor, enabling the organs to retain moisture while creating rich, savory characteristics that appeal to many palates.

Are There Age Restrictions for Consuming Beef Organs?

In general, there are no designated age restrictions for consuming beef organs. However, it is suggested for young children, pregnant women, and individuals with certain health conditions to consult a healthcare professional before introducing them to their diet.
